Who is Carey Lowell? Beyond her captivating roles on screen and on the runway, Carey Lowell is a woman of multifaceted talents and a life as rich and varied as her career.
From the heights of the fashion world to the depths of cinematic intrigue, Carey Lowell's journey has been nothing short of remarkable. Born in Huntington, New York, on February 11, 1961, Lowell's early life was shaped by a unique upbringing, constantly moving due to her father's career as a distinguished geologist. This nomadic childhood, spent in locations spanning the globe, instilled in her a sense of adventure and a broad perspective on life.

Before gracing the silver screen, Lowell made a significant mark in the fashion industry. With her striking features and statuesque height, she quickly became a sought-after model, walking the runways for top American designers like Calvin Klein and Ralph Lauren. Her career took her to the forefront of the fashion world, allowing her to experience the glamour and artistry of haute couture. Her modeling career began when she was hired by the Ford Modeling Agency right after finishing high school, a testament to her natural beauty and poise.
Lowell's transition into acting was marked by a memorable role in the 1989 James Bond film "Licence to Kill," where she played Pam Bouvier. This role not only introduced her to a wider audience but also cemented her status as a Bond girl, a title that signifies a blend of beauty, intelligence, and charisma. She reprised the voice role of Pam Bouvier in the 2012 video game "007 Legends," further demonstrating the enduring legacy of her character. The actress also appeared in the "Bond Girls Are Forever" documentary, which highlighted her role within the iconic Bond franchise.
Following this initial success, Lowell continued to explore her acting career, taking on various roles that showcased her versatility. She delivered compelling performances in films such as "Sleepless in Seattle," "Love Affair," and "Fierce Creatures". Notably, she is also celebrated for her role as Assistant District Attorney Jamie Ross in the long-running television series "Law & Order". This role allowed her to demonstrate her range as an actress and further solidified her place in Hollywood, showcasing her ability to handle complex, nuanced characters.
Lowell's work in "Law & Order" is particularly notable, as it highlighted her ability to portray strong, intelligent women. As Jamie Ross, she brought a sense of realism and depth to the role, making her a favorite with viewers. The character became one of the most remembered characters in the show's history, a testament to her acting skills and the way she connected with the audience.
Beyond her professional life, Lowell's personal life has also been a subject of interest. She was married to actor Richard Gere from 2002 to 2016. Their relationship, though eventually ending in divorce, captured the attention of the media and public. The pair have a son, Homer, now in his twenties.

Lowells upbringing had a significant impact on her life and career. Growing up in diverse locations, the daughter of a geologist, she was exposed to different cultures and environments. This global upbringing has undoubtedly contributed to her open-mindedness and her adaptability. Her father, James Lowell, was voted Scientist of the Year in 1979 by the Rocky Mountain Association of Geologists, highlighting the intellectual environment in which she was raised.
